kevinchen19870316 wrote:

here's the combo i'll be throwing the heavier ones in the pic

loomis forcelite 10-17lb( wish it was 15-25lb)

calais 100a

73m fireline 30lb with bimini twist at end

1.8m 60lb leader( hopefully i can get black magic tough) or 5m wind on 80lb leader if i still get bust offs)

all rings on lures will be changed to 40lb test rings. all lures i'll throw will have new hooks that can hold up to 30lb force.

when fishing, i'll keep drag at least 10lb-12lb at all stages of fight.

the action of some lures will not be as strong as when they carried light hardware but i've tried my best to minimise the impact of heavy tackle. i've put oversized rings in the lures i'll throw on this gear and i will use a jerking retrieve rather than just winding them in so that they can still entice hits when carrying heavy hardware.
